TSTP Solution File: SYN077+1 by Drodi---3.5.1

View Problem - Process Solution

%------------------------------------------------------------------------------
% File     : Drodi---3.5.1
% Problem  : SYN077+1 : TPTP v8.1.2. Released v2.0.0.
% Transfm  : none
% Format   : tptp:raw
% Command  : drodi -learnfrom(drodi.lrn) -timeout(%d) %s

% Computer : n012.cluster.edu
% Model    : x86_64 x86_64
% CPU      : Intel(R) Xeon(R) CPU E5-2620 v4 2.10GHz
% Memory   : 8042.1875MB
% OS       : Linux 3.10.0-693.el7.x86_64
% CPULimit : 300s
% WCLimit  : 300s
% DateTime : Wed May 31 12:45:55 EDT 2023

% Result   : Theorem 0.12s 0.37s
% Output   : CNFRefutation 0.20s
% Verified : 
% SZS Type : -

% Comments : 
%------------------------------------------------------------------------------
%----WARNING: Could not form TPTP format derivation
%------------------------------------------------------------------------------
%----ORIGINAL SYSTEM OUTPUT
% 0.04/0.13  % Problem  : SYN077+1 : TPTP v8.1.2. Released v2.0.0.
% 0.04/0.14  % Command  : drodi -learnfrom(drodi.lrn) -timeout(%d) %s
% 0.12/0.35  % Computer : n012.cluster.edu
% 0.12/0.35  % Model    : x86_64 x86_64
% 0.12/0.35  % CPU      : Intel(R) Xeon(R) CPU E5-2620 v4 @ 2.10GHz
% 0.12/0.35  % Memory   : 8042.1875MB
% 0.12/0.35  % OS       : Linux 3.10.0-693.el7.x86_64
% 0.12/0.35  % CPULimit : 300
% 0.12/0.35  % WCLimit  : 300
% 0.12/0.35  % DateTime : Tue May 30 10:24:10 EDT 2023
% 0.12/0.35  % CPUTime  : 
% 0.12/0.36  % Drodi V3.5.1
% 0.12/0.37  % Refutation found
% 0.12/0.37  % SZS status Theorem for theBenchmark: Theorem is valid
% 0.12/0.37  % SZS output start CNFRefutation for theBenchmark
% 0.12/0.37  fof(f1,axiom,(
% 0.12/0.37    (! [Y] :(? [Z] :(! [X] :( big_f(X,Z)<=> X = Y ) )))),
% 0.12/0.37    file('/export/starexec/sandbox2/benchmark/theBenchmark.p')).
% 0.12/0.37  fof(f2,conjecture,(
% 0.12/0.37    ~ (? [W] :(! [X] :( big_f(X,W)<=> (! [U] :( big_f(X,U)=> (? [Y] :( big_f(Y,U)& ~ (? [Z] :( big_f(Z,U)& big_f(Z,Y) ) )) )) )) ))),
% 0.12/0.37    file('/export/starexec/sandbox2/benchmark/theBenchmark.p')).
% 0.12/0.37  fof(f3,negated_conjecture,(
% 0.12/0.37    ~(~ (? [W] :(! [X] :( big_f(X,W)<=> (! [U] :( big_f(X,U)=> (? [Y] :( big_f(Y,U)& ~ (? [Z] :( big_f(Z,U)& big_f(Z,Y) ) )) )) )) )))),
% 0.12/0.37    inference(negated_conjecture,[status(cth)],[f2])).
% 0.12/0.37  fof(f4,plain,(
% 0.12/0.37    ![Y]: ?[Z]: ![X]: ((~big_f(X,Z)|X=Y)&(big_f(X,Z)|~X=Y))),
% 0.12/0.37    inference(NNF_transformation,[status(esa)],[f1])).
% 0.12/0.37  fof(f5,plain,(
% 0.12/0.37    ![Y]: ?[Z]: ((![X]: (~big_f(X,Z)|X=Y))&(![X]: (big_f(X,Z)|~X=Y)))),
% 0.12/0.37    inference(miniscoping,[status(esa)],[f4])).
% 0.12/0.37  fof(f6,plain,(
% 0.12/0.37    ![Y]: ((![X]: (~big_f(X,sk0_0(Y))|X=Y))&(![X]: (big_f(X,sk0_0(Y))|~X=Y)))),
% 0.12/0.37    inference(skolemization,[status(esa)],[f5])).
% 0.12/0.37  fof(f7,plain,(
% 0.12/0.37    ![X0,X1]: (~big_f(X0,sk0_0(X1))|X0=X1)),
% 0.12/0.37    inference(cnf_transformation,[status(esa)],[f6])).
% 0.12/0.37  fof(f8,plain,(
% 0.12/0.37    ![X0,X1]: (big_f(X0,sk0_0(X1))|~X0=X1)),
% 0.12/0.37    inference(cnf_transformation,[status(esa)],[f6])).
% 0.12/0.37  fof(f9,plain,(
% 0.12/0.37    ?[W]: (![X]: (big_f(X,W)<=>(![U]: (~big_f(X,U)|(?[Y]: (big_f(Y,U)&(![Z]: (~big_f(Z,U)|~big_f(Z,Y)))))))))),
% 0.12/0.37    inference(pre_NNF_transformation,[status(esa)],[f3])).
% 0.12/0.37  fof(f10,plain,(
% 0.12/0.37    ?[W]: ![X]: ((~big_f(X,W)|(![U]: (~big_f(X,U)|(?[Y]: (big_f(Y,U)&(![Z]: (~big_f(Z,U)|~big_f(Z,Y))))))))&(big_f(X,W)|(?[U]: (big_f(X,U)&(![Y]: (~big_f(Y,U)|(?[Z]: (big_f(Z,U)&big_f(Z,Y)))))))))),
% 0.12/0.37    inference(NNF_transformation,[status(esa)],[f9])).
% 0.12/0.37  fof(f11,plain,(
% 0.12/0.37    ?[W]: ((![X]: (~big_f(X,W)|(![U]: (~big_f(X,U)|(?[Y]: (big_f(Y,U)&(![Z]: (~big_f(Z,U)|~big_f(Z,Y)))))))))&(![X]: (big_f(X,W)|(?[U]: (big_f(X,U)&(![Y]: (~big_f(Y,U)|(?[Z]: (big_f(Z,U)&big_f(Z,Y))))))))))),
% 0.12/0.37    inference(miniscoping,[status(esa)],[f10])).
% 0.12/0.37  fof(f12,plain,(
% 0.12/0.37    ((![X]: (~big_f(X,sk0_1)|(![U]: (~big_f(X,U)|(big_f(sk0_2(U,X),U)&(![Z]: (~big_f(Z,U)|~big_f(Z,sk0_2(U,X)))))))))&(![X]: (big_f(X,sk0_1)|(big_f(X,sk0_3(X))&(![Y]: (~big_f(Y,sk0_3(X))|(big_f(sk0_4(Y,X),sk0_3(X))&big_f(sk0_4(Y,X),Y))))))))),
% 0.12/0.37    inference(skolemization,[status(esa)],[f11])).
% 0.12/0.37  fof(f13,plain,(
% 0.12/0.37    ![X0,X1]: (~big_f(X0,sk0_1)|~big_f(X0,X1)|big_f(sk0_2(X1,X0),X1))),
% 0.12/0.37    inference(cnf_transformation,[status(esa)],[f12])).
% 0.12/0.37  fof(f14,plain,(
% 0.12/0.37    ![X0,X1,X2]: (~big_f(X0,sk0_1)|~big_f(X0,X1)|~big_f(X2,X1)|~big_f(X2,sk0_2(X1,X0)))),
% 0.12/0.37    inference(cnf_transformation,[status(esa)],[f12])).
% 0.12/0.37  fof(f15,plain,(
% 0.12/0.37    ![X0]: (big_f(X0,sk0_1)|big_f(X0,sk0_3(X0)))),
% 0.12/0.37    inference(cnf_transformation,[status(esa)],[f12])).
% 0.12/0.37  fof(f16,plain,(
% 0.12/0.37    ![X0,X1]: (big_f(X0,sk0_1)|~big_f(X1,sk0_3(X0))|big_f(sk0_4(X1,X0),sk0_3(X0)))),
% 0.12/0.37    inference(cnf_transformation,[status(esa)],[f12])).
% 0.12/0.37  fof(f17,plain,(
% 0.12/0.37    ![X0,X1]: (big_f(X0,sk0_1)|~big_f(X1,sk0_3(X0))|big_f(sk0_4(X1,X0),X1))),
% 0.12/0.37    inference(cnf_transformation,[status(esa)],[f12])).
% 0.12/0.37  fof(f18,plain,(
% 0.12/0.37    ![X0]: (big_f(X0,sk0_0(X0)))),
% 0.12/0.37    inference(destructive_equality_resolution,[status(esa)],[f8])).
% 0.12/0.37  fof(f19,plain,(
% 0.12/0.37    ![X0,X1]: (big_f(X0,sk0_1)|~big_f(sk0_1,sk0_3(X0))|~big_f(sk0_4(sk0_1,X0),X1)|big_f(sk0_2(X1,sk0_4(sk0_1,X0)),X1))),
% 0.12/0.37    inference(resolution,[status(thm)],[f17,f13])).
% 0.12/0.37  fof(f20,plain,(
% 0.12/0.37    ![X0,X1,X2]: (~big_f(sk0_4(sk0_1,X0),X1)|~big_f(X2,X1)|~big_f(X2,sk0_2(X1,sk0_4(sk0_1,X0)))|big_f(X0,sk0_1)|~big_f(sk0_1,sk0_3(X0)))),
% 0.12/0.37    inference(resolution,[status(thm)],[f14,f17])).
% 0.12/0.37  fof(f21,plain,(
% 0.12/0.37    spl0_0 <=> big_f(sk0_1,sk0_1)),
% 0.12/0.37    introduced(split_symbol_definition)).
% 0.12/0.37  fof(f22,plain,(
% 0.12/0.37    big_f(sk0_1,sk0_1)|~spl0_0),
% 0.12/0.37    inference(component_clause,[status(thm)],[f21])).
% 0.12/0.37  fof(f24,plain,(
% 0.12/0.37    spl0_1 <=> ~big_f(sk0_4(sk0_1,sk0_1),X0)|big_f(sk0_2(X0,sk0_4(sk0_1,sk0_1)),X0)),
% 0.12/0.37    introduced(split_symbol_definition)).
% 0.12/0.37  fof(f25,plain,(
% 0.12/0.37    ![X0]: (~big_f(sk0_4(sk0_1,sk0_1),X0)|big_f(sk0_2(X0,sk0_4(sk0_1,sk0_1)),X0)|~spl0_1)),
% 0.12/0.37    inference(component_clause,[status(thm)],[f24])).
% 0.12/0.37  fof(f27,plain,(
% 0.12/0.37    ![X0]: (big_f(sk0_1,sk0_1)|~big_f(sk0_4(sk0_1,sk0_1),X0)|big_f(sk0_2(X0,sk0_4(sk0_1,sk0_1)),X0)|big_f(sk0_1,sk0_1))),
% 0.20/0.38    inference(resolution,[status(thm)],[f19,f15])).
% 0.20/0.38  fof(f28,plain,(
% 0.20/0.38    spl0_0|spl0_1),
% 0.20/0.38    inference(split_clause,[status(thm)],[f27,f21,f24])).
% 0.20/0.38  fof(f29,plain,(
% 0.20/0.38    spl0_2 <=> ~big_f(sk0_4(sk0_1,sk0_1),X0)|~big_f(X1,X0)|~big_f(X1,sk0_2(X0,sk0_4(sk0_1,sk0_1)))),
% 0.20/0.38    introduced(split_symbol_definition)).
% 0.20/0.38  fof(f30,plain,(
% 0.20/0.38    ![X0,X1]: (~big_f(sk0_4(sk0_1,sk0_1),X0)|~big_f(X1,X0)|~big_f(X1,sk0_2(X0,sk0_4(sk0_1,sk0_1)))|~spl0_2)),
% 0.20/0.38    inference(component_clause,[status(thm)],[f29])).
% 0.20/0.38  fof(f32,plain,(
% 0.20/0.38    ![X0,X1]: (~big_f(sk0_4(sk0_1,sk0_1),X0)|~big_f(X1,X0)|~big_f(X1,sk0_2(X0,sk0_4(sk0_1,sk0_1)))|big_f(sk0_1,sk0_1)|big_f(sk0_1,sk0_1))),
% 0.20/0.38    inference(resolution,[status(thm)],[f20,f15])).
% 0.20/0.38  fof(f33,plain,(
% 0.20/0.38    spl0_2|spl0_0),
% 0.20/0.38    inference(split_clause,[status(thm)],[f32,f29,f21])).
% 0.20/0.38  fof(f96,plain,(
% 0.20/0.38    ![X0,X1]: (~big_f(sk0_1,X0)|~big_f(X1,X0)|~big_f(X1,sk0_2(X0,sk0_1))|~spl0_0)),
% 0.20/0.38    inference(resolution,[status(thm)],[f22,f14])).
% 0.20/0.38  fof(f97,plain,(
% 0.20/0.38    ![X0]: (~big_f(sk0_1,X0)|big_f(sk0_2(X0,sk0_1),X0)|~spl0_0)),
% 0.20/0.38    inference(resolution,[status(thm)],[f22,f13])).
% 0.20/0.38  fof(f99,plain,(
% 0.20/0.38    big_f(sk0_2(sk0_0(sk0_1),sk0_1),sk0_0(sk0_1))|~spl0_0),
% 0.20/0.38    inference(resolution,[status(thm)],[f97,f18])).
% 0.20/0.38  fof(f107,plain,(
% 0.20/0.38    sk0_2(sk0_0(sk0_1),sk0_1)=sk0_1|~spl0_0),
% 0.20/0.38    inference(resolution,[status(thm)],[f99,f7])).
% 0.20/0.38  fof(f110,plain,(
% 0.20/0.38    ![X0]: (~big_f(X0,sk0_0(sk0_1))|~big_f(X0,sk0_2(sk0_0(sk0_1),sk0_1))|~spl0_0)),
% 0.20/0.38    inference(resolution,[status(thm)],[f96,f18])).
% 0.20/0.38  fof(f111,plain,(
% 0.20/0.38    ![X0]: (~big_f(X0,sk0_0(sk0_1))|~big_f(X0,sk0_1)|~spl0_0)),
% 0.20/0.38    inference(forward_demodulation,[status(thm)],[f107,f110])).
% 0.20/0.38  fof(f119,plain,(
% 0.20/0.38    ~big_f(sk0_1,sk0_1)|~spl0_0),
% 0.20/0.38    inference(resolution,[status(thm)],[f111,f18])).
% 0.20/0.38  fof(f120,plain,(
% 0.20/0.38    $false|~spl0_0),
% 0.20/0.38    inference(forward_subsumption_resolution,[status(thm)],[f119,f22])).
% 0.20/0.38  fof(f121,plain,(
% 0.20/0.38    ~spl0_0),
% 0.20/0.38    inference(contradiction_clause,[status(thm)],[f120])).
% 0.20/0.38  fof(f125,plain,(
% 0.20/0.38    spl0_6 <=> big_f(sk0_1,sk0_3(sk0_1))),
% 0.20/0.38    introduced(split_symbol_definition)).
% 0.20/0.38  fof(f127,plain,(
% 0.20/0.38    ~big_f(sk0_1,sk0_3(sk0_1))|spl0_6),
% 0.20/0.38    inference(component_clause,[status(thm)],[f125])).
% 0.20/0.38  fof(f144,plain,(
% 0.20/0.38    big_f(sk0_1,sk0_1)|spl0_6),
% 0.20/0.38    inference(resolution,[status(thm)],[f127,f15])).
% 0.20/0.38  fof(f145,plain,(
% 0.20/0.38    spl0_0|spl0_6),
% 0.20/0.38    inference(split_clause,[status(thm)],[f144,f21,f125])).
% 0.20/0.38  fof(f153,plain,(
% 0.20/0.38    ![X0,X1]: (~big_f(sk0_4(sk0_1,sk0_1),X0)|~big_f(sk0_4(sk0_2(X0,sk0_4(sk0_1,sk0_1)),X1),X0)|big_f(X1,sk0_1)|~big_f(sk0_2(X0,sk0_4(sk0_1,sk0_1)),sk0_3(X1))|~spl0_2)),
% 0.20/0.38    inference(resolution,[status(thm)],[f30,f17])).
% 0.20/0.38  fof(f156,plain,(
% 0.20/0.38    spl0_10 <=> big_f(sk0_4(sk0_1,sk0_1),sk0_0(sk0_4(sk0_1,sk0_1)))),
% 0.20/0.38    introduced(split_symbol_definition)).
% 0.20/0.38  fof(f158,plain,(
% 0.20/0.38    ~big_f(sk0_4(sk0_1,sk0_1),sk0_0(sk0_4(sk0_1,sk0_1)))|spl0_10),
% 0.20/0.38    inference(component_clause,[status(thm)],[f156])).
% 0.20/0.38  fof(f164,plain,(
% 0.20/0.38    $false|spl0_10),
% 0.20/0.38    inference(forward_subsumption_resolution,[status(thm)],[f158,f18])).
% 0.20/0.38  fof(f165,plain,(
% 0.20/0.38    spl0_10),
% 0.20/0.38    inference(contradiction_clause,[status(thm)],[f164])).
% 0.20/0.38  fof(f166,plain,(
% 0.20/0.38    ![X0]: (~big_f(sk0_4(sk0_1,sk0_1),sk0_3(X0))|big_f(X0,sk0_1)|~big_f(sk0_2(sk0_3(X0),sk0_4(sk0_1,sk0_1)),sk0_3(X0))|big_f(X0,sk0_1)|~big_f(sk0_2(sk0_3(X0),sk0_4(sk0_1,sk0_1)),sk0_3(X0))|~spl0_2)),
% 0.20/0.38    inference(resolution,[status(thm)],[f153,f16])).
% 0.20/0.38  fof(f167,plain,(
% 0.20/0.38    ![X0]: (~big_f(sk0_4(sk0_1,sk0_1),sk0_3(X0))|big_f(X0,sk0_1)|~big_f(sk0_2(sk0_3(X0),sk0_4(sk0_1,sk0_1)),sk0_3(X0))|~spl0_2)),
% 0.20/0.38    inference(duplicate_literals_removal,[status(esa)],[f166])).
% 0.20/0.38  fof(f168,plain,(
% 0.20/0.38    ![X0]: (~big_f(sk0_4(sk0_1,sk0_1),sk0_3(X0))|big_f(X0,sk0_1)|~spl0_1|~spl0_2)),
% 0.20/0.38    inference(forward_subsumption_resolution,[status(thm)],[f167,f25])).
% 0.20/0.38  fof(f175,plain,(
% 0.20/0.38    big_f(sk0_1,sk0_1)|big_f(sk0_1,sk0_1)|~big_f(sk0_1,sk0_3(sk0_1))|~spl0_1|~spl0_2),
% 0.20/0.38    inference(resolution,[status(thm)],[f168,f16])).
% 0.20/0.38  fof(f176,plain,(
% 0.20/0.38    spl0_0|~spl0_6|~spl0_1|~spl0_2),
% 0.20/0.38    inference(split_clause,[status(thm)],[f175,f21,f125,f24,f29])).
% 0.20/0.38  fof(f179,plain,(
% 0.20/0.38    $false),
% 0.20/0.38    inference(sat_refutation,[status(thm)],[f28,f33,f121,f145,f165,f176])).
% 0.20/0.38  % SZS output end CNFRefutation for theBenchmark.p
% 0.20/0.38  % Elapsed time: 0.025553 seconds
% 0.20/0.38  % CPU time: 0.061847 seconds
% 0.20/0.38  % Memory used: 11.852 MB
%------------------------------------------------------------------------------